Abstract:Brandt’s vole(Lasiopodomys brandtii) isan important rodent species in typical grassands,and the analysis of its dietarycandepen the understanding of the foraging strategy of Brandt’s vole and provide a cer tainreference for the rational management of Brandt’s vole population.In this study,we collected 20 ( 109 , 10↑ ) stomach contents per month from adult Brandt’s voles in May,July,September,and November 2O22 in typi cal grasslands of Dongwuzhumqin Banner, Xilingol League,Inner Mongolia,respectively,for a total of 80(40 $\mathcal { f } , 4 0 \mathrm { ~ \texthat { ~ } { ~ } ~ } )$ stomach contents in 2O22. Seasonal diferences were analyzed using DNA macro-barcoding technology for dietary identification. The results showed that:(1)a total of 16 plant species from 9 families and 14 genera were identified in the stomach contents of Brandt’s voles.(2) there was no significant seasonal diference in the diet diversity of Brandt’s voles,but the diet richnesswas significantly higher in autumn than in summer ( P<0.01 )andwinter( .(3)There were significant seasonal differences in the proportions of Brandt's voles feeding on Astragalus membranaceus,Allium polyrhizum, Cleistogenes squarrosa,Chloris virgata,Potentilla bifurca and Parthenocissus tricuspidate ⋅P<0.05) .There were highly significant seasonal diferences in feeding on Oxybasis glauca,Leymus chinensis,Eragrostis minor and Alium ramosum ( 》
